Do you want to join a team that is building tailored technical solutions to modernize our government’s mission and our client’s business? Do you have a desire to change how people work? Are you interested in helping to protect our nation’s cyber interests? Join our growing team supporting the government agencies in it's mission as a Recruiter.
- Join a dedicated team of highly skilled recruiters working together to rapidly grow our company, expanding our reach on multiple government contracts
- The primary responsibility is driving a smooth recruitment process for the sourcing and recruiting of direct-hire openings
- Types of positions range from technical (engineering) professionals and management in the information technology field
- Responsible for building a strong technical talent pipeline and helping to hire and retain skilled employees to support multiple openings across the company portfolio
- Be able to convey full suite of company capabilities as well as key benefit information, applying best practices in a friendly way
- Heavy emphasis will be on sourcing from various databases to identify cleared, technical talent to support various contracts
- Review resumes, conduct initial chats, to analyze applicant’s abilities and to ensure candidates share company values
- At a high level, the candidate process includes application review, or reach out, conducting phone screening, negotiating salary with internal team, and submitting resume, and customer interviews, and providing timely feedbacks
- Utilize multiple internet resources, including job boards and social media
- You’ll use negotiation skills along with a creative and positive mindset to remove blockers
- Track and manage ATS system (knowledge of iCIMS is a plus) to process and move candidates as they progress through various hiring stages
- Maintain candidate contact and advocacy through the entire hiring process. You would be their personal guide from step to step
- Network with potential candidates to promote and attract top technology professionals
- The candidate hiring process can take an average of 1-2 months. During this time, you would stay in contact with check-ins, keeping the candidate engaged and excited
- Possess strong client focus with the ability to build trust with stakeholders and support them in executing ambitious growth plans
- Assist with other talent acquisition projects and administrative tasks
- Assist in sending weekly recruiting team status reports to leadership
- Other duties as assigned
Location This is a remote, work-from-home position. Work may be performed within these states DC, FL, MD, MO, SD, VA, WV
Education and Experience
- Bachelor Degree or the equivalent education/experience
- Minimum 2 year of technical recruiting experience
- This is a 100% remote work role that requires a self-starter with a strong work ethic and integrity
- Technical expertise with an ability to understand and explain job requirements for IT roles
- Familiarity with Applicant Tracking Systems and resume databases
- Familiarity with security clearances supporting roles in the Federal Sector
- Solid knowledge of sourcing techniques (e.g. social media recruiting, boolean searches, etc.)
- Enjoy finding creative and/or more efficient ways to solve problems
- Proactive qualities with the willingness to learn
- Good at synthesizing key points from group discussions
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Strong customer service skills and ability to interact with all levels of the organization
- Ability to manage, protect, and maintain confidential information
- Strong organizational skills
- Ability to multi-task and change courses quickly without compromising accuracy
- Problem-solving skills and ability to identify solutions through research
-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ative team
- Committed and dependable
- Experience recruiting in the National and Military Intelligence and DoD space
- An understanding of the word "Prime"
- Understanding of the US government security clearance process
- Familiarity with OFCCP compliance rules and regulations
